I just bought a bmw 535 xi 2008 e60. car started to jerk a bit when I start moving (auto, 1st, 2nd gears) at around 1500 - 2000 RPM. But if I accelerate it and go out quickly I don't feel any jerk.
It doesn't matter the gear or the speed. It's my first BMW and I don't know where to start. Someone who has had this problem can help me.


Anyone have any ideas?
